2009 Audi Q7 vs. 2000 Dodge Ram

To start off, 2009 Audi Q7 is newer by 9 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2000 Dodge Ram.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2000 Dodge Ram would be higher. At 4,163 cc (8 cylinders), 2009 Audi Q7 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2009 Audi Q7 (350 HP @ 6800 RPM) has 177 more horse power than 2000 Dodge Ram. (173 HP @ 4800 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2009 Audi Q7 should accelerate faster than 2000 Dodge Ram.

Both vehicles are four wheel drive (4WD) - it offers better handling, traction, and control in all driving conditions compared with front wheel drive or r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2009 Audi Q7 (441 Nm @ 3500 RPM) has 136 more torque (in Nm) than 2000 Dodge Ram. (305 Nm @ 3200 RPM). This means 2009 Audi Q7 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2000 Dodge Ram.
